Is Placido Mar Safe?
It's average — crime is comparable to the national average. Placido Mar in West Palm Beach, FL has a safety grade of C. The overall crime index is 178, which is 78% above the national average of 100.
Compared to the West Palm Beach average (crime index 125), Placido Mar is 53% higher in overall crime. Residents and visitors should exercise extra caution in this area, particularly after dark.
Looking at specific crime types, larceny / theft is the most elevated concern (index: 191, 91% above average), while rape is the lowest risk (index: 93). Property crime is more prevalent than violent crime here, consistent with broader national patterns.
